Book Overview
This book takes a unique approach by focusing on the universal concepts of modular and structured programming, making it language-agnostic at its core. While the text explains programming logic, data structures, and algorithms independent of any specific language, it frequently uses C++ to illustrate key ideas. This dual focus ensures that readers understand the 'why' behind programming before diving into the 'how' of syntax. The book progresses from simple to complex topics, building a strong foundation that is essential for tackling advanced languages like Java, Python, or C# later on.

Inside the Book
The content is organized to guide readers through the entire programming lifecycle. Early chapters cover fundamental building blocks such as variables, data types, and control structures. As the book progresses, it delves into functions, arrays, pointers, and file handling, all within the framework of modular design. Each chapter includes clear explanations, annotated code examples, and review questions that test comprehension. The book also introduces debugging techniques and best practices for writing clean, efficient code.
Key Topics
- Fundamentals of Programming: Understanding algorithms, pseudocode, and flowcharting.
- Data Types and Operators: Integers, floats, characters, and logical operations in C++.
- Control Structures: Conditional statements (if-else, switch) and looping (for, while, do-while).
- Modular Programming: Functions, scope, parameter passing, and recursion.
- Arrays and Strings: One-dimensional and multi-dimensional arrays, string manipulation.
- Pointers and Dynamic Memory: Pointer arithmetic, memory allocation, and deallocation.
- File Input/Output: Reading from and writing to external files.
- Structured Debugging: Techniques to identify and fix logical errors.
